Output fbaa18ca2f412bb00a551f35b4dd678bc302fb769a36c92d06b63fcfe429dc4e:1

value
11498
script pubkey
OP_0 OP_PUSHBYTES_20 37626ed75fc3b3796cfeb54e59d6315f44201070
address
bc1qxa3xa46lcwehjm87k489n433tazzqyrs67ct6p
transaction
fbaa18ca2f412bb00a551f35b4dd678bc302fb769a36c92d06b63fcfe429dc4e
confirmations
510
spent
false

1 Sat Range